2054:求表达式结果

Time/Memory Limit:1000 MS/32768 K
Submitted: 1154 Accepted: 408

 Problem Description

计算(1!)^2+(2!)^2 +(3!)^2 +(4!)^2 +...+(n!)^2 的值。(用函数完成n!)
提示:本题用int会超出其表示数的范围,所以需要使用__int64类型,其使用方法如下:
用VC调试时使用:
__int64 x=0;
printf("%I64d",x);

 Input

输入数据有多组,每组占一行,包含一个正整数n(1<n<12)

 Output

对于每组输入数据,输出结果,每个测试实例占一行。

 Sample Input

1
2 

 Sample Output

1
5

 Author

zh

 Recommend

zh